What is a Thru Tubing job?

A Thru Tubing job involves performing downhole interventions using specialized tools that pass through the production tubing without removing it. These operations are typically used for well cleanouts, fishing, milling, or stimulation to enhance production. Thru Tubing services are crucial for maintaining and optimizing well performance while minimizing downtime and costs associated with full workovers.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Thru Tubing position, and why are they important?

To thrive in Thru Tubing roles, you need a solid understanding of downhole tool deployment, well intervention techniques, and oilfield safety protocols, often gained through relevant field experience or technical training. Familiarity with specialized equipment such as coiled tubing units, hydraulic tractors, and knowledge of pressure control systems or Well Control certifications are commonly required. Strong problem-solving abilities, effective teamwork, and clear communication help technicians excel when adapting to changing well conditions and collaborating with rig crews. These competencies are essential for ensuring successful tool operations, minimizing risk, and maintaining safety in demanding oilfield environments.

Workover Solutions, Inc. is a dynamic and growing technology company in the energy sector, committed to innovation, sustainability, and delivering high-quality service to our clients.  We are seeking a Thru-Tubing Specialist to support wellsite operations. This role is responsible for executing specialized downhole service work safely, accurately, and in compliance with company, customer, and regulatory requirements. The position is well suited for someone who values hands-on technical work, follows established procedures closely, and maintains high service quality in field environments.

Requirements

  • Perform wellsite operations including fishing, milling, toe preps, cleanout, acid wash, and nitrogen lift services
  • Plan and execute job procedures in accordance with operating guidelines, safety standards, and customer requirements
  • Make up, break down, transport, and deliver downhole tools as needed for field operations
  • Record and prepare accurate job logs, time sheets, BHA diagrams, safety meeting records, tickets, and other required documentation
  • Calculate job parameters such as flow rates, velocities, and snubbing loads to support safe and effective execution
  • Provide technical support to customers and advise on proper operating procedures for tools and services
  • Maintain service quality throughout operations and ensure all reporting requirements are completed on time
  • Build and maintain customer relationships and support sales calls when needed
  • Train and mentor new employees on procedures, safety expectations, and field practices
  • Communicate directly with the District Manager regarding job execution, service quality, and tool performance feedback
